CANNES
Description:
Cannes with its world-famous Promenade de la Croisette is definitely a city that can be best visited by walking it. This resort on the French Riviera is one of the most visited city in France and is especially well-known thanks to its very important annual film festival, the Festival of Cannes when thousands of celebrities and the film industry crowd flocks to its shores. Cannes has a great choice of luxury hotels to accommodate those celebrities and for instance the hotel Carlton reflects perfectly well the spirit of the Belle Epoque which one can still feel in Cannes. There is more to Cannes than the film festival and the glitz of the Croisette. It also has all the characteristics of the Provence and you will feel the original atmosphere of an old fishing village. Its old quarter built on a rocky mount overlooking the sea and its period properties, winding alleys and Chateau de Cannes offer a fine example of historic Cannes. The walls and the terrace of the Castre Tower museum provide an incredible view of the old port, the Croisette, the islands of Lerins and the Esterel mountain range. You will also find numerous markets to stroll through with the best-know one called the Forville which is opened every day as well as other artisanal and arts markets.
Climate
Cannes is on to the French Riviera and enjoys a mild climate. The winters are temperate (not below 10 ° C), while summers are dry and warm (average temp. 22 ° C in July). There is very little rainfall with most of it falling between September and February.Transport
The nearest airport, “Nice Côte d%27Azur” is located in the nearby city of Nice. The airport is connected to the center of Cannes with an Express bus (price is 15 € or the mini-“Cannes Express” bus for 20 €). The journey takes about 45 minutes. There is also a cheaper bus connection, the TAM (Transport Alpes-Maritimes), leaving from Terminal 1 of Nice Airport to Cannes. The price is just 1 € but be prepared for a 2-hours ride with frequent stops. Still, the best way to get around in Cannes is just to walk. For the lazy ones, Cannes has a bus service that costs as little as 1€ per trip.
